In the spring, the Middle School’s science, technology, and mathematics departments work together to expand student’s horizons.
Students at Dunes Academy are challenged to apply STEM (science, technology, engineering, and mathematics) to better understand community issues and provide workable solutions.
Students zero focus on genuine questions and come up with their own experiments, probes, and technical solutions to solve actual issues.
Each student in middle school is handed a Chromebook for usage during the school year. Teachers may utilise Schoology, an online learning management system, to keep tabs on their kids’ progress and share that information with parents.
Students may benefit from taking electives in areas such as art, family and consumer science, health, technology, financial literacy, careers, chorus, and band.
While kids in middle school do study some computer science, podcasting, and broadcasting as part of their required curriculum, they also have the choice to pursue optional classes in these areas if they so desire.
Our middle school students have access to a wide variety of extracurricular activities, including football, volleyball, cross country, basketball, wrestling, track and field, as well as band, choir, yearbook, talented and gifted programs, and after-school events. Students benefit from a developmentally appropriate curriculum that is delivered by our attentive and hardworking teachers.
The vast campus at Dunes Academy in the peaceful rural town of Tehsil Aau in the Phalodi District of Rajasthan, India, is a wonderfully stunning setting.
